Banister Removal in Denver County, CO

Banister removal services involve the safe and efficient dismantling of stair railings, handrails, and associated components within residential properties. This service is often requested during home renovations, remodeling projects, or when replacing outdated or damaged banisters.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of work, including whether the removal will affect surrounding structures or require repairs afterward, as well as any considerations for disposing of old materials.

Before requesting banister removal, homeowners should clarify the type of banisters involved, such as wood, metal, or composite materials, and whether the project includes partial or complete removal. It is also important to consider access points, potential for structural modifications, and any local regulations or building codes that may influence the process.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the project proceeds smoothly and meets safety and aesthetic expectations.

Banister Removal Questions

What types of banisters can be removed? Banister removal services typically handle wood, metal, and composite banisters, regardless of design or style.

Is banister removal suitable for interior or exterior stairs? Yes, services can remove banisters from both interior and exterior staircase areas as needed.

Are there any considerations before removing a banister? Property owners should consider the structural role of the banister and any building codes that may apply.

What projects commonly require banister removal? Common projects include remodeling, staircase updates, or preparing for new railing installations.
